Directions

  1. Mix all together in a large bowl.
  2. Store in a large, glass jar. (not plastic).
  3. Serve 1/2 cup with skim milk and no fat yogurt, and some stewed fruit or blue berries.
  4. It's a good idea to let muesli sit for a few minutes in the milk, to soften the oats. You can eat it cold or warm it in the microwave.
